Taxonomic Classification

Rank alpine silverwort arrow-finned squid
Kingdom Plantae (Plants)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Marchantiophyta (liverwort) Mollusca (Mollusks)
Class Jungermanniopsida (Jungermanniopsida) Cephalopoda (Cephalopods)
Order Jungermanniales (Jungermanniales) Oegopsida (Oegopsida)
Family Antheliaceae Ommastrephidae
Genus Anthelia Illex
Species Anthelia julacea Illex oxygonius

alpine silverwort

The Alpine silverwort (Anthelia julacea) is a species in the genus Anthelia. It is currently classified as Least Concern on the IUCN Red List. Native to Europe, inhabiting ecosystems characteristic of the region. Distributed across Norway and Sweden.

arrow-finned squid

The Arrow-finned squid, Illex oxygonius, is a species. It is currently assessed as least concern on the IUCN Red List.
